Officiating analysis has not made the same transition: existing work and public discussion still rely heavily on foul rates, foul differentials, reviewed late-game correctness labels, or team/player benefit from calls. This leaves an empirical gap because a low-leverage foul in a decided game should not be treated as equivalent to a whistle that materially shifts win probability in a close game.
